It is a: Humectant, drawing moisture into the skin Emollient, helping to soften skin Solvent, dispersing and stabilizing formulas Preservative booster, enhancing the antimicrobial activity of other preservatives Carbomer is a synthetic thickening and gelling agent. It's basically the ingredient that gives a lot of serums, gels, creams, and sunscreens their smooth, non-sticky texture. Although legally permitted at very high levels, carbomers are normally used at concentrations below 1%. It also needs to be neutralized to actually thicken, and because it is a large molecule, it doesn't really penetrate the skin barrier. Allergy-wise, the risk is very low. Clinical studies show carbomers have low potential for skin irritation/sensitization even at concentrations up to 100%. A 2024 UK study patch-tested 1,302 patients and found true allergy to the parent group of carbomer to be rare with no confirmed relevant reactions. Glycerin (or glycerol) is a compound naturally found in your skin. It's a powerhouse humectant that pulls water into the stratum corneum. Topically, glycerin does several things at once: Your skin makes glycerin on its own (mostly from sebaceous oil breakdown) and shuttles it to your outermost layer of skin, or your epidermis, via aquaporin-3. Aquaporin-3 is a transporter that is essential for normal skin hydration, elasticity, and repair. Interestingly, mice lacking in AQP3 have dry and less elastic skin that can be fully corrected with glycerin. This ingredient is non-irritating, plays well with almost every ingredient, and works across all skin types. Typical use is anywhere between 3-10% but can go up to 79% in some leave-on products. Just know very high concentrations (>40%) can feel tacky in low humidity. Glycerin is the name for this ingredient in American English. British English uses Glycerol/Glycerine. Niacinamide is a multitasking form of vitamin B3 that strengthens the skin barrier, reduces pores and dark spots, regulates oil, and improves signs of aging. And the best part? It's gentle and well-tolerated by most skin types, including sensitive and reactive skin. You might have heard of "niacin flush", or the reddening of skin that causes itchiness. Niacinamide has not been found to cause this. In very rare cases, some individuals may not be able to tolerate niacinamide at all or experience an allergic reaction to it. If you are experiencing flaking, irritation, and dryness with this ingredient, be sure to double check all your products as this ingredient can be found in all categories of skincare. When incorporating niacinamide into your routine, look out for concentration amounts. Typically, 5% niacinamide provides benefits such as fading dark spots.
